Investigation of Bartonella infection in rats by molecular technology
FU Gui-Ming, SUN Ji-Min, YANG Zhang-Nv, YANG Tian-Ci, SI Guo-Jing, PANG Wei-Long, GONG Zhen-Yu, LIU Qi-Yong
Abstract1283)      PDF (1297KB)(1163)      

【Abstract】 Objective To investigate the infection of Bartonella in rat?shape animals by molecular technology. Methods Rat?shape animals were captured by night trap in Tiantai county of Zhejiang province. DNA from rat livers were detected by PCR, and the positive products were sequenced. The infection rate of Bartonella in rat was calculated. Results There were 25 positive samples among 55 samples collected. The positive rate of Bartonella infection in Apodemus agrarius and Rattus losea were 48.84% and 33.33%, respectively. The sequence was more similar to B.doshiae. Conclusion The infection rate of Bartonella in rat?shape animals was higher in Tiantai county, and there was risk of transmitting this pathogen to human. The control measure should be figured out.
